Entryway Essentials: Making a Lasting First Impression
Your entryway is often the first glimpse guests have of your home, making its flooring crucial.
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) emerges as a top contender here, offering water resistance and scratch durability.
Kitchen Considerations: Where Style Meets Functionality
The kitchen requires flooring that can handle spills, splatters, and constant activity.
Tile in durable materials like ceramic or porcelain offers timeless elegance and easy cleaning.

Bathroom Brilliance: Waterproofing & Style in Harmony
Bathrooms require unwavering water resistance and slip-proof surfaces.
Tile reigns supreme here, with porcelain or ceramic tiles offering excellent durability.

Playroom Perfection: Durability & Safety Combined
Playrooms demand resilience against spills, messes, and active playtime.
Soft cushioned vinyl tiles provide extra shock absorption for young knees.
